Postmortem follow-up: the stale-cache bug in Quillhopper's session layer meant recovery links pointed at expired tokens. Fix shipped in 4.2.1, but old caches linger up to 48 hours. If a user is stuck, flush their entry and re-run recovery with the fallback admin account, which unlocks with the passphrase below.

vault phrase of bahop-yahaf = novael-ralir-gilox-praeth

Handover note — Crumbwheel order cutoffs.

Welcome aboard. The bakery cutoff rule in Crumbwheel closes same-day orders at 14:00 local to each storefront, not UTC — this has bitten us twice. Holiday overrides live in the calendar service and take precedence silently, so always check there first when a cutoff looks wrong. To unlock the calendar service's admin console after a restart, enter the recovery passphrase below.

vault phrase of bagap-bahaf = silion-pelox-sorox-casdor-quenwyn-fraax-eliox-praael-kelion-quenvan-kasox-rusael-norius-belvan

Step 4: Enable SQL linting in Quarrelstone CI. All .sql files under /warehouse must pass the new ruleset before merge — uppercase keywords, explicit JOINs, no SELECT *. Legacy files in /warehouse/archive are exempt until Q3. Reviewers should block any PR that disables rules inline. The linter reads its settings from the block that follows.

config for bagep-kageg:
ULADOR_LOG_LEVEL=warn
ULADOR_METRICS_HOST=metrics.ulador.tolvaqcorp.corp
ULADOR_POOL_SIZE=32

**Ticket: Config drift on BounceSift processor**

The email bounce processor in the Larkfield environment has drifted from the values committed in the release branch. Retry windows and suppression thresholds no longer match, which likely explains the duplicate suppression entries reported Tuesday. Please reconcile before the Thursday cut. For reference, the currently deployed configuration on the live node reads as follows.

config for yajep-yahof:
[briax]
port = 9200
region = outer-2
host = briax.nelvrocorp.test
team = raleth
timeout_ms = 1500
retries = 1